Welcome to West Sandford ...

West Sandford is located in Edgar County<1>.


The location of West Sandford has been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(ie- the GNIS).<2>


A typical abbreviation for West Sandford: W. Sandford

West Sandford is 620 feet [189 m] above sea level.<3>.

Time Zone: West Sandford lies in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time

Note: While West Sandford is in the Central Time Zone, the area just to the east is in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T).

West Sandford is located in the (217) area code.
